Regular Website Updates and Upgrades

One of the most important web maintenance practices is to keep your website’s software up-to-date. This includes content management systems, plugins and other applications. Regular updates and upgrades are essential for enhancing your website’s performance, user experience and competitiveness in the market. Ensure that you are consistently adding fresh and unique content to your website. Update existing material, remove outdated information and introduce new content to provide ongoing value to your audience. Regularly refreshing your website’s content encourages visitors to return and engage with your site more frequently.

In addition to content updates, website upgrades involve making significant improvements to the design and functionality of your site. Remember that what seems modern today may quickly become outdated. Consider adopting a new design theme or template to give your website a fresh and modern appearance.

Website Backups

Making regular backups is one of the easiest and most effective Johor web maintenance tasks to safeguard against potential crises. Depending on the specific needs of your site, backups can be scheduled monthly, weekly or even daily. By maintaining a backup, you are prepared for any worst-case scenario, allowing for a quick and easy restoration of your website. Having a backup system in place not only protects you from data loss but also provides peace of mind when implementing updates that could potentially cause issues.

Fixing Broken Links and Errors

Regularly checking your website for broken links and errors is a vital part of your web maintenance routine. Ensure that all external and internal links function properly. Broken links can lead to frustrating 404 errors which detract from the user experience. Tools like Screaming Frog can help identify these errors quickly. By addressing broken links and ensuring all connections work correctly, you contribute to a smoother browsing experience for your users which can positively impact your website’s credibility.

Security Checks

Website security is paramount among web maintenance practices. Without proper security measures, your site becomes vulnerable to cyber attacks, risking both your sensitive information and that of your users. Establishing robust security protocols is essential for maintaining user trust. If visitors encounter security issues like malware warnings, it can severely damage their confidence in your brand. Search engines prioritize secure websites. It means that your visibility can be adversely affected without the right protections in place.

Make it a routine to install the latest bug fixes and security patches. Outdated plugins can contain vulnerabilities that hackers can exploit. Always ensure your security certificates are up-to-date to maintain the integrity of encrypted connections.

Performance Testing and Monitoring

Testing and monitoring your website’s performance is crucial for catching potential issues before they escalate. If your website loads slowly or experiences frequent downtime, it could harm your brand reputation and user trust. Regularly assess your website’s performance to identify any slow-loading pages or outages. This proactive approach can help you maintain a high-quality user experience, ensuring visitors stay engaged with your content.

Media Optimization

Optimizing your media library is another essential web maintenance routine. Regularly remove old, unused or duplicate images and videos from your database. Prioritize optimizing your photos before uploading them to your site and update any existing unoptimized files to enhance load times. If your website is running slower than usual, optimizing your media library should be one of the first areas to investigate.

Statistics Analyzing

Utilizing analytics tools such as Google Analytics can provide invaluable insights into your website’s performance and its connection with your target audience. Key metrics to focus on include the number of unique visitors, audience demographics, page views and engagement metrics. Using these statistics, you can tailor your web maintenance routine to create content that meets the needs and interests of your audience. Identify gaps in the market that your competitors may not be addressing, and brainstorm new content ideas to fill these niches.
